What is the best time of year to take photos at The TradeWinds?

The best time for photography at The TradeWinds depends on your preference.

  • Spring and Fall: These shoulder seasons offer pleasant temperatures, fewer crowds, and clear skies, ideal for capturing crisp, vibrant photos.
  • Summer: Expect bright sunshine and warm weather, perfect for beach scenes, but also potential for hazy conditions. Early mornings and late afternoons offer softer light for photography.
  • Winter: While the weather is cooler, you might encounter fewer crowds and some stunning sunsets, though cloud cover can be more frequent.

What type of camera equipment is recommended for photographing The TradeWinds?

While a smartphone camera can capture decent photos, investing in a DSLR or mirrorless camera will allow for greater control over your images. Consider a wide-angle lens for capturing sweeping landscape shots and a telephoto lens for capturing details from a distance. A tripod is highly recommended, especially for sunset photography. Don't forget extra batteries and memory cards!

Are there any restrictions on photography at The TradeWinds?

While photography is generally encouraged at The TradeWinds, it's always a good idea to be mindful of other guests and respect their privacy. Avoid photographing individuals without their consent. Check with the resort regarding any specific restrictions on drone photography or professional photo shoots.
